Camms.Risk features and specs

  • Comprehensive Risk Management
    Camms.Risk offers a holistic approach to risk management by including various modules such as risk identification, assessment, mitigation, and reporting.
  • Customizable Dashboards
    The platform allows users to create customizable dashboards that provide a real-time overview of key risk metrics, making it easier to monitor and manage risks.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    Camms.Risk has an intuitive and easy-to-navigate interface, which reduces the learning curve for new users and enhances the overall user experience.
  • Integration Capabilities
    The system offers strong integration capabilities with other enterprise software, enhancing its utility and ensuring seamless data flow across different applications.
  • Regulatory Compliance
    The platform helps organizations meet various regulatory compliance requirements by providing standardized templates and reporting features.

Possible disadvantages of Camms.Risk

  • Cost
    Camms.Risk can be relatively expensive, especially for small to mid-sized organizations, limiting its accessibility to larger enterprises with bigger budgets.
  • Complexity in Customization
    While the software offers extensive customization options, these can be complex and time-consuming to set up, requiring specialized knowledge.
  • Limited Offline Access
    The platform requires an internet connection to access most functionalities, limiting its usability in remote or low-connectivity areas.
  • Initial Setup
    The initial setup process can be cumbersome and may require significant time and resources to align with an organization's specific needs.
  • Customer Support
    Some users have reported that customer support can be slow to respond during peak times, which can be frustrating when immediate assistance is needed.

SAP PPM features and specs

  • Comprehensive Project Management
    SAP PPM provides a full suite of tools for managing projects from start to finish, enabling users to define, plan, execute, and monitor projects effectively, ensuring that all project aspects are cohesively handled.
  • Integration with SAP Ecosystem
    Seamless integration with other SAP modules like SAP ERP and SAP S/4HANA allows for efficient data flow across various business processes, enhancing overall operational efficiency.
  • Robust Portfolio Management
    Tools for prioritizing, balancing, and optimizing portfolios provide organizations with insights into resource allocation and investment decisions, ensuring alignment with strategic objectives.
  • Real-Time Reporting and Analytics
    Advanced analytics and reporting capabilities provide real-time insights into project status and performance, aiding informed decision-making and proactive management.
  • Scalability and Flexibility
    The platform can scale with an organization as it grows, and its configurable settings allow it to be tailored to specific business needs and industry requirements.

Possible disadvantages of SAP PPM

  • Complex Implementation
    The initial setup and configuration of SAP PPM can be complex and time-consuming, often requiring specialized expertise and a significant commitment of resources.
  • High Cost
    SAP PPM can be expensive, particularly for smaller companies with limited budgets, due to its licensing fees and the potential need for specialized consulting services.
  • Steep Learning Curve
    Users might face a steep learning curve due to the robustness and complexity of the system, necessitating extensive training to leverage its full functionality effectively.
  • Overhead for Small Projects
    The comprehensive features, while beneficial for large and complex projects, might introduce unnecessary overhead and complexity for smaller or less resource-intensive projects.
  • Dependence on IT Support
    Organizations may need continuous IT support and maintenance to address any technical issues and ensure smooth operation, which can add to the overall operational cost.
